16 Timeless Wedding Movies for Every Romantic

There are movies that feature weddings, and then there are wedding movies—as in, Hollywood flicks focused almost exclusively on the lead-up to walking down the aisle. It’s a surprisingly robust genre; but then again, weddings are often billed as the biggest day of one’s life, marked both by love and a life-altering decision. Sounds like a scenario perfect for plot development, if you ask me.

Below, find the best wedding movies ever, from classic rom-coms (NB: if it stars Julia Roberts or Hugh Grant, watch it), to moody dramas and indie darlings. 

Four Weddings and a Funeral (1994)

As the title suggests, this film is set over the course of four weddings and a funeral—and the many hiccups, hilarities, and heartbreaks that occur therein, especially between Hugh Grant’s Charles and Andie MacDowell’s Carrie. It’s the first film Grant made with director Richard Curtis (later works would include Notting Hill and Bridget Jones’s Diary), and the one that made him a household name. To this day, it’s considered one of the best British films of all time.
